- Abstract
The study examines the potential of Artificial Intelligence (AI) to optimize citizen engagement platforms in creating sustainable urban futures, inclusive policy-making and community-oriented smart government. So, we contribute to a body of literature mainly centred on theory or about a specific AI application, in addition, this study provides empirical insights and pragmatic frameworks enhancing the real-life deployment of AI for urban governance, sustains and strengthens it. Filling the voids present in citizen engagement technologies, stale perspectives in citizen engagement, and a lack of diversity within case studies, this paper aims to offer tangible solutions to implement AI tools with the goal of enhancing citizen agency, decision-making processes, and inclusive policies. Context-aware, AI-driven platforms that can assist citizens in discussing their problems and expectations with policymakers can create opportunities for a more connected, transparent, responsive, and adaptive urban governance framework. By deeply examining the latest advancements in AI, this project seeks to foster the emergence of smarter, more participatory cities, empowering citizens to play a co-architectural role in their built environments.
